From 9f3a4c266d65ba901229efedbe8a1574a563ae8f Mon Sep 17 00:00:00 2001 From: Balthasar Reuter Date: Tue, 14 Jan 2025 23:25:47 +0100 Subject: [PATCH] Install CDO and perform bitidentity testing in GH Actions --- .github/workflows/build.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 56417b80..2fccc7ab 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-81,7 +81,7 @@ jobs: brew install ninja else sudo apt-get update - sudo apt-get install ninja-build libcurl4-openssl-dev + sudo apt-get install ninja-build libcurl4-openssl-dev cdo fi printenv @@ -173,7 +173,7 @@ jobs: dependency_branch: develop dependency_cmake_options: | ecmwf-ifs/fiat: "-G Ninja -DCMAKE_BUILD_TYPE=${{ matrix.build_type }} -DENABLE_TESTS=OFF" - cmake_options: "-G Ninja -DCMAKE_BUILD_TYPE=${{ matrix.build_type }} ${{ matrix.cmake_options }} -DENABLE_SINGLE_PRECISION=ON" + cmake_options: "-G Ninja -DCMAKE_BUILD_TYPE=${{ matrix.build_type }} ${{ matrix.cmake_options }} -DENABLE_SINGLE_PRECISION=ON -DENABLE_BITIDENTITY_TESTING=ON" ctest_options: "${{ matrix.ctest_options }}" # - name: Codecov Upload